Group 1: Financial Allocation and Development Focus - Tianjin's 2026 budget allocates 8.7 billion yuan for high-quality development of technology enterprises and 10.2 billion yuan for employment funds, aiming to enhance fiscal capacity and improve public welfare [1] - The budget emphasizes support for major projects that drive the Beijing-Tianjin-Hebei coordinated development, focusing on innovation chain collaboration and the transformation rate of technological achievements [1] - The city plans to invest in the Tianjin-Kai High Education Science and Technology Park and support the construction of international technology innovation centers, with a focus on modern traditional Chinese medicine and synthetic biology [1] Group 2: Agricultural and Rural Development - 8.7 billion yuan will be allocated for agricultural subsidies to protect arable land, purchase agricultural machinery, and develop high-standard farmland covering 328,000 acres [2] - The budget includes support for modern facility agriculture transformation and the development of rural industries, with plans to enhance rural infrastructure [2] Group 3: Consumer and Investment Stimulus - The city will implement a consumption promotion campaign with a budget of 300 million yuan, aimed at boosting sectors like dining and tourism [3] - Plans include extending support for electric vehicle consumption and optimizing policies for international consumer center city development [3] - The budget will utilize special bonds and long-term treasury bonds to invest in new productivity and comprehensive human development [3] Group 4: Resource Optimization and Urban Renewal - The city aims to activate underutilized public rental housing and municipal properties, promoting market-oriented operations of public resources [4] - Urban renewal initiatives will introduce new industries into old factories and historical buildings [4] Group 5: Social Welfare and Infrastructure Improvement - The budget allocates 10.2 billion yuan for employment initiatives, including job stabilization and vocational training [5] - Plans include the construction and expansion of 10 primary and secondary schools, adding 17,000 new student places [5] - The city will enhance elderly care services and provide subsidies for elderly and childcare services [5] Group 6: Healthcare and Urban Infrastructure - Key healthcare projects, such as the construction of the Third Central Hospital's East Lijiang District, will be accelerated [6] - The budget includes plans for the renovation of old neighborhoods and the upgrade of 1,700 kilometers of outdated pipelines [6] - Transportation improvements will feature the completion of the first phase of Metro Line 8 and the opening of 10 new school bus routes [6]
